OPD: Bloomfield Man with Priors Allegedly Drove Barred, Searched by K-9 Unit

A Bloomfield man with prior convictions allegedly drove barred and was searched by a K-9 unit, according to the Ottumwa Police Department.

34-year-old Jonathan McFarland was charged with driving while barred, possession of a firearm or offensive weapon by a DA offender, possession of a controlled substance – second offense, and possession of drug paraphernalia.

On October 4 at 1:30 p.m., court records say officers recognized McFarland to have an invalid driver’s license and conducted a traffic stop. McFarland attempted to flee but complied with officers after they commanded him by his name to stop.

Authorities conducted a probable cause search with a K-9 unit and located a drawstring bag by McFarland’s feet. Authorities found a loaded handgun, a container with 17.2 grams of methamphetamine, and a plastic bag with 0.4 grams of methamphetamine.

Officers also located two glass smoking pipes, a digital scale, and another container and plastic bag. All items contained methamphetamine residue.

Court records say McFarland’s license is barred and he has an expired registration. He has two previous domestic abuse convictions and is prohibited from possessing firearms. He also has a prior drug related conviction for methamphetamine.

McFarland was transported to the Wapello County Jail. He is being held with a $5,000 bond, waived his preliminary hearing, and plead not guilty.
